About

Swarm Universe, released in 2017, is an indie top-down shooter that stands out for its highscore-driven gameplay and extensive modding capabilities. Players can dive into various challenges, from fast-paced arenas to skill-testing racetracks and engaging mini-games, all while competing online against others. The modding tools allow gamers to create custom levels and game modes, making each experience unique and highly replayable.

When it comes to PC performance, Swarm Universe is quite accessible, requiring only an entry-level GPU with a minimum score of around 565. With just 2 GB of RAM, even budget systems can run the game smoothly. For optimal FPS and to enjoy higher graphics settings, a mid-range GPU, such as the NVIDIA GTX 960 or AMD Radeon R7 370, is recommended, providing the performance boost needed for more intense multiplayer matches and intricate user-generated content.

Considering its 70/100 rating, Swarm Universe is worth a try, especially for fans of indie games and competitive shooters. The unique blend of modding and multiplayer elements offers both casual and hardcore gamers an engaging experience that encourages creativity and skill.

Performance profile

March 2017 release. Swarm Universe was built around the GTX 10-series / RX Vega era. Current-gen mid-range cards (RTX 4060 / RX 7600) are overkill at 1080p and handle 1440p Ultra comfortably.

Indie and casual titles are typically light on hardware. Swarm Universe runs well on almost any modern GPU, including integrated graphics on recent laptops — you won't need a dedicated card for a smooth experience.

Extremely light — Swarm Universe runs at 60 FPS 1080p on any integrated GPU (Intel Iris Xe, AMD Radeon Graphics) or a decade-old discrete card like the GTX 1050. A current-gen RTX 4060 pushes 4K Ultra without effort.
